BRYAN ROONEY, GRANT JOHNSON, MIRANDA PRIEBE How Does Defense Spending Affect Economic Growth?

n recent years, there has been a growing debate about the U.S. role in the world, or U.S. grand strategy. A grand strategy guides choices about how to manage relations with allies and adver- saries, where to forward deploy U.S. forces, and how much to spend on defense. Some analysts Iargue that the remains incredibly powerful and geographically distant from its adversaries, allowing it to remain secure with a reduced global footprint and without spending as much on defense as in previous years.1 Others argue that the threats to the United States are plenti- ful and must be countered with policies that require the current or an even higher level of defense

KEY FINDINGS

This report is the first in a series on the security and economic trade-offs associated with competing visions for U.S. grand strategy—that is, the U.S. approach to the world. We focus on an underexamined aspect of the decision calculus about U.S. grand strategy: the relation- ship between U.S. defense spending and economic growth. We arrive at the following key conclusions:

■ Prioritizing defense spending over infrastructure investment, a long-standing domestic con- cern, might undermine economic growth and, therefore, resources available for defense in the long run.

■ Prior to the pandemic response, spending on national defense was roughly half of discretion- ary spending, so defense spending contributes notably to annual deficits, even if it is not the main driver.

■ Economists generally believe that the rising U.S. public debt will eventually undermine growth, but there is disagreement as to exactly when or how.

■ As public debt rises, there is a risk that defense spending might eventually have a deleterious effect on growth, unlike during the Cold War, when public debt was lower.

■ The economic literature is not conclusive on how increasing taxes to maintain or increase defense spending would affect economic growth. affordable. Defense spending generates jobs directly and can improve economic output indirectly through the spillover of technology and human capital to the civilian economy. However, defense spending also has opportunity costs because it diverts resources from government programs that might do more to promote growth.
